Output a21052603cd3e123ebc74d341414c6669abaf009e784867b753ea0b23e206559:0

value
4302065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a749bfd68bcdeb92172f56eae9b3466dbaca941 OP_EQUAL
address
32eJNcxNsBdZrE4eFUiFD5ViDiWZALwW93
transaction
a21052603cd3e123ebc74d341414c6669abaf009e784867b753ea0b23e206559
spent
true